Tropical Rice

South Dakota Honey Cookbook Volume 1, p. 57

2 cups white rice

2 tsp. butter

1 tsp. salt

4 cups water

¾ cup honey

1 tsp. ginger

1 tsp. cinnamon

1 16 oz. can Mandarin orange segments, drained

1 15 ½ oz. can chunky fruit cocktail, drained

Bring water to a boil. Add butter, salt and rice. Return to boil. Stir, cover, reduce heat and simmer for 25 minutes. Do not lift lid. Place cooked rice in bowl adding honey and spices while still hot.

Next add drained fruit, tossing slightly.
